MantelDescription
A pair of fluted pilasters, square in section, rest on block plinths and rise to form brackets which support the ogee molded shelf. The cornice is also fluted, the marble surround is plain around a square opening.Dimensions

Historical OverviewNote
The marble mantel and fireplace surround in the gardenside (north) parlor of the Monroe House is believed to be original to the structure's 1805 construction.Update Date
